Virtualization
Virtualization has taken IT by storm over the past few years. Starting with server virtualization, IT shops have now turned their eyes toward other critical infrastructure areas, including desktop virtualization. Desktone enables enterprises to take advantage of desktop virtualization without the significant costs and risks normally associated with deploying packaged software solutions.

Cloud Computing
There is much hope and promise for cloud computing and the impact many expect it to have on enterprise IT. While most attention to date has been around moving enterprise server workloads into the cloud, Desktone believes that it will actually be desktops that lead the charge.

SaaS
Software is rapidly evolving from packaged products that enterprises purchase and deploy internally to services that they access over the Internet. Desktone views SaaS as a stepping stone to DaaS (Desktops as a Service) where not just singular applications, but entire desktops will be consumed as an outsourced, subscription service.

Green Computing
The desire and need to become more "green" is impacting IT as much as other parts of enterprises. As enterprises consider virtual desktop deployments, there are a number of green items that need to be considered. For example, while the focus has been primarily on end-user devices, the hosting infrastructure must also be taken into account.
